Qu'est-ce qu'un Exemple de Diagramme de Classe pour DAB ?
Un Exemple de Diagramme de Classe pour DAB est une représentation visuelle de la structure statique et des relations entre les classes dans un système de Distributeur Automatique de Billets (DAB). Ce diagramme UML illustre les attributs, méthodes et associations des composants clés des opérations DAB.
Les principaux éléments de ce diagramme incluent généralement des classes telles que Client, Carte, DAB, Banque et Compte. Chaque classe contient des attributs (par exemple, numéro de compte, code PIN) et des méthodes (par exemple, retirer(), déposer()) qui définissent ses propriétés et comportements. Les relations entre les classes, telles que l'héritage et l'association, sont montrées à travers des lignes de connexion.
Ce puissant outil de modélisation est utilisé par les développeurs de logiciels et les analystes système pour concevoir et comprendre l'architecture des systèmes DAB. En décrivant clairement la structure du système, il facilite une meilleure communication entre les membres de l'équipe, aide à identifier les problèmes potentiels tôt dans le processus de développement et sert de plan pour l'implémentation.
Pourquoi utiliser un Modèle de Diagramme de Classe pour DAB ?
Un modèle de diagramme de classe pour DAB offre un cadre structuré pour visualiser et concevoir les relations complexes entre les classes dans un système de DAB. Il peut vous aider à créer rapidement un modèle complet sans partir de zéro.
- Rationalisation de la conception du système : Le modèle offre une structure pré-définie de classes communes au DAB comme Client, Carte, et Terminal, vous permettant de vous concentrer sur la personnalisation des attributs et méthodes spécifiques au lieu de construire le diagramme entier depuis le début.
- Amélioration de la compréhension : En utilisant ce modèle, vous pouvez facilement visualiser les interactions entre les différents composants du système DAB, ce qui simplifie l'explication de l'architecture du système aux parties prenantes ou aux membres de l'équipe.
- Amélioration de la cohérence : Le modèle garantit que vous incluez tous les éléments essentiels d'un système DAB, réduisant le risque d'oublier des composants critiques et maintenant la cohérence à travers différents projets ou itérations.
- Faciliter le développement logiciel : Avec un diagramme de classe clair, vous pouvez accélérer le processus de codage en fournissant aux développeurs un plan de la structure du système, potentiellement réduisant le temps de développement jusqu'à 30%.
Comment utiliser un Exemple de Diagramme de Classe pour DAB avec l'IA
Il est beaucoup plus facile d'utiliser l'IA pour remplir le contenu dans le modèle Exemple de Diagramme de Classe pour DAB. Suivez ces étapes pour utiliser efficacement le modèle :
- Étape 1 : Entrez votre système DAB spécifique : Tapez les détails du système DAB, l'IA générera le contenu du diagramme de classe.
- Étape 2 : Editez les classes et relations générées par l'IA : Demandez à l'IA de modifier ou d'étendre les classes, attributs et méthodes.
- Étape 3 : Exporter et partager : Exportez le diagramme de classe complété sous forme d'image ou partagez le lien.
Utiliser l'IA simplifie le processus de création d'un Exemple de Diagramme de Classe pour DAB, vous permettant de vous concentrer sur l'affinement de l'architecture du système. Cette approche est similaire à la création d'autres diagrammes UML, tels que les diagrammes de séquence ou les diagrammes de cas d'utilisation, mais spécifiquement adaptée aux systèmes DAB.